The train operators at the Sprinter Rail Facility in Escondido, Calif., chose SMART Transportation Division representation in a May 28 vote.
In a unanimous vote, the Sprinter operators opted for representation under the SMART umbrella.
The Sprinter line is a 22-mile long light rail train system between Oceanside, Vista, San Marcos and Escondido, Calif., serving 15 stations.
The Sprinter runs every 30 minutes in each direction, Monday through Thursday, from approximately 4 a.m. to 9 p.m. Friday and Saturday trains run later.
It is managed Veolia Transportation Services, Inc., a major operator of commuter and regional rail services worldwide.
SMART TD Director of Organizing Rich Ross thanks all involved for “this complete team effort.”
